On behalf of our family of faith here at Sacred Heart Church, I welcome you to our new website. Our historic church is located on Peachtree St., in the heart of downtown Atlanta. Our church is considered one of the most beautiful in the southeastern U.S., and we have the distinction of being the only church in Atlanta with two spires. Ours is a warm, friendly and diverse congregation, offering a great variety of ministries and outreach services to our growing number of individuals and families. In recent years our parish family has nearly doubled (from 600 to 1200 registered households). We come from all parts of the metropolitan area, including members from different socio-economic levels, racial and ethnic groups, and lifestyles. Our schedule of Masses and opportunities for confession are set up to accommodate not only our parishioners, but also guests from nearby hotels and others who work in the downtown area.
This coming year we are celebrating the 130th anniversary of our founding. Many of the original Catholic families of Atlanta worshipped here a century ago, but we’ve lost none of our beauty, our energy, and our love for Christ and the mission of the Church in this 21st century.
